Combating waste in rural Moldova
Rural regions of Moldova continue to face challenges related to unregulated waste disposa and the absence of an effective waste management system.
Caritas Czech Republic assists local authorities in starting sustainable waste management practices. We support local residents in reducing waste production and recycling correctly. We promote composting as a way to manage organic waste and reduce greenhouse gas emissions.

Cleaner countryside in Georgia
Rural development is just as important as urban development. In the mountainous regions of Georgia, we help to develop waste management infrastructure and provide training to local people on waste sorting. We have acquired waste collection vehicles and support the development of recycling infrastructure.
We also introduce the benefits of composting to farmers in mountainous areas to reduce the environmental impact of organic waste.
